I applied to Duke's nurse anesthesia program with overall GPA 3.65, science GPA 3.8, GRE verbal 620 , GRE Math 780, and GRE Writing 5. And I got accepted. I had 3 years of "solid foundation" of critical care experience while working in a Coronary Care Unit (CCU) of a community hospital in South Carolina (but I'm a NC resident). Certified Registered Nurse Anesthetists have been practicing at Duke University Medical Center for more than 50 years. We currently have more than 100 CRNAs on staff. (919) 684-8111.The Doctor of Nursing Practice (DNP) in Nurse Anesthesia Program is for experienced critical care RNs who hold a bachelor's degree and wish to become certified registered nurse anesthetists (CRNAs). It is a 36-month, full-time, front-loaded program that includes a 21-month clinical anesthesia residency. Morrow said at their bedside he was intrigued by the ICU nurse’s knowledge and compassion and empowered by the poise and expertise that the …What is the structure of program curriculum? The program is structured into 2 phases. The first phase is front-loaded, classroom, didactic learning, supplemented by work in clinical simulation, and the anatomy/cadaver lab. The second phase is the clinical and research project phase, consisting of 50-60 hours + on-call per week of clinical work.The Post-BSN to DNP Pathway for Nurse Anesthesia is accredited by the Council on Accreditation of Nurse Anesthesia Educational Programs (COA) with full continued accreditation through May 2031. East Carolina University College of Nursing Nurse Anesthesia Program. 3112 Health Science Building.Of the 124 CRNA schools in total, 87 schools publish the average number of anesthesia cases completed. Meanwhile, 37 nurse anesthetist schools do not release any information. The average number of anesthesia cases at CRNA programs is 889 cases . The Nurse Anesthesia program provides small, intimate gNurse Anesthesia — MSN Program. The COA requires that all stud The Nurse Anesthesia Program is a nine semester, 36 month program of study. The student's time commitment is approximately 40-64 hours per week. This time commitment includes study time. One hour of classroom time generates two or more hours of study time.
